At City Thameslink, ticket buying facilities are robust, with a ticket office open from 07:15 to 19:45 on weekdays. For those purchasing tickets online, collection is straightforward and can be done through accessible machines at the station. These machines also support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ring inclusivity for all passengers.
For those requiring assistance, staff are available from 05:00 to 23:30 on weekdays and from 08:00 to 21:00 on Saturdays. While the station itself features step-free access via the Ludgate Hill entrance, note that the Holborn Viaduct entrance requires stair access. Help points are strategically located, ready to provide immediate assistance should it be needed.
Although there's no waiting room, seating is available on both platforms, which are below ground, offering a snug waiting experience. CCTV helps bolster security to enhance passenger safety. While the station has no luggage storage, refreshing facilities, including vending machines and shops, fulfill your needs should hunger strike. For those looking to purchase tickets, Bourne End Station offers a ticket office open weekdays from 06:05 to 12:35 and on Saturdays from 07:05 to 13:35. While there is no service on Sunday, ticket machines are available 24/7 for your convenience. Additionally, there's full accessibility support with accessible ticket machines and induction loops.
The station is equipped with CCTV for security and customer help points for any information you may need. You can stay informed about your journey with departure screens and announcements. Even though there's no luggage storage, and lost property services are limited, there's comfort in knowing the essentials are covered.
Accessibility is a strong point here. Featuring step-free access across the platforms with a short ramp from the car park, Bourne End ensures ease of transit for everyone. While there are no waiting rooms or first-class lounges, the seating areas provide a place to settle while you wait. For those who require assistance, staff help is available from Monday to Saturday.
While shopping facilities are not present, you can quench your thirst with refreshment options via vending machines on Platform 1. There's free space for bicycles, and cycling to the station makes for an eco-friendly commute option with secure racks and stands available.
When it comes to additional transport, Bourne End doesn’t disappoint. Though taxi services directly at the station are unavailable, buses conveniently stop just outside the station. This connects you efficiently to Marlow and Maidenhead, providing smooth transitions onward. If you're catching a flight, transfer at Reading for Heathrow and Gatwick links or Bristol Temple Meads for Bristol Airport.
Planning to cycle further? While there is no bicycle hire service available at Bourne End, bicycle storage is plentiful, securing peace of mind for bike owners.
